What is the reason for 2 mufflers on the 240? Is it REALLY necessary to have two mufflers?? Just wondering. ;o)








  REPLY TO THIS MESSAGE    PRINT   SAVE 

Exhausted.......... 200

Detailer explained why there are 2 mufflers.

In answer to your other question, no, it is not necessary to have both. In fact, IPD sells a "sport" exhaust kit which increases the pipe diameter, and replaces the middle muffler with a straight pipe. I bought one, but haven't installed it yet. IPD describes it as slightly louder, but not objectionable.
